1樓:可靠的
excel中常規格式和日期格式的轉換規則如下:
1900/1/1為起始日期,轉換的數字是0,往後的每一天增加11900/1/2轉換為數字是 1
1900/1/3轉換為數字是 2
1900/1/4轉換為數字是 3
以此類推
2013/8/27距離1900/1/1一共是41513天因此41513轉換為日期就是2013/8/27excel中時間轉換規則如下:在時間中的規則是把1天轉換為數字是 1
每1小時就是 1/24
每1分鐘就是 1/(24×60)=1/1440每1秒鐘就是 1/(24×60×60)=1/86400驗證:1、輸入數個由日期加時間組成的資料,選擇複製,並在空白單元格上使用選擇性黏貼
2、選擇數值黏貼
3、2019/3/19距離1900/1/1為43543天,14:49轉換為數值為0.62,相加即可驗證
2樓:匿名使用者
在execel中
數字0 代表日期 1900-1-0 ,即這個日期為起始日期,算是第0天
數字1 代表日期 1900-1-1 ,即第一天數字2 代表日期 1900-1-2 ,即第二天......
數字41513 代表 2013-8-27 ,即第41513天在時間中的規則是把1
分成24份 =1/24 ,每一份就是1個小時,分成1440份 =1/(24*60) ,每一份就是1分鐘,分成86400份 =1/(24*60*60) ,每一份就是1秒
3樓:tat蘿蔔
日期在excel裡實際是數值,是從1900-1-1開始到該日期的天數如輸入數值2,轉換為日期後就是1900-1-2如果日期中含有小數,則小數部分表示時間
小數部分*24,得到的整數為小時
剩餘的小數*60,得到的整數為分鐘
剩餘的小數再*60,得到的整數為秒
4樓:漂哥
1、操作法:右鍵,設定單元格格式,日期(時間),確定
2、函式公式:輸入 =text(a1,"emmdd") =text(a1,"hhmmss")
補充下:規則是數字0作為日期即1900-1-0,數字1則為1900-1-1,以此類推
數字中的整數部分是日期,小數部分*24代表時間(24小時/天),例數字1.1,指1.1天,1天又2.
4小時。數字1.1換成日期時間格式就是 1900-1-1 2:
24:00
小時中的小數部分*60代表分鐘(60分鐘/小時),2.4小時即2小時24分鐘
分鐘中的小數部分*60代表秒(60秒/分鐘)。
5樓:
計算機有兩種日期計算方法:
1、2023年1月1日確定為1,這個是excel預設的標準;
2、2023年1月1日確定為1,這個需要在excel選項中進行設定;
以後每過一天加1。
excel用一個浮點數代表日期時間的資料,整數部分為日期,小數部分為時間,當單元格格式設定為日期型別時,就自動轉化為日期時間格式了,如41513就是1990-1-1後的41512天,就是2013-8-27;
小數部分除以24(每天24小時)的整數部分就是小時,它的小數部分除以60,得到的整數就部分就是分鐘,小數部分再除以60,得到的就是秒、毫秒.......
在excel設計了很多日期時間函式,能夠完成格式的轉換和計算等;
如:date()、year()、month()、day(),teim()、hour().....
如何把excel中常規格式轉換為yyyy mm dd格式
若a1 20081201 轉化為日期型 b1 date mid a2,1,4 mid a2,5,2 mid a2,7,8 或 牛飛陽 如果想獲得年月等繼續計算,只能加輔助列,如樓上的 if len a1 6,text a1,0000 00 text a1,0000 00 00 如果只為顯示,可自定義...
excel數字是常規格式,無法自動求和
常規格式可以自動求和的,不能自動求和應該有其他原因,再檢視一下 見好就收 你把格式設定成資料格式 計算時公式中 1即可變為數值格式 對於之前設定為文字方式的單元格,錄入數字後,再改單元格格式為常規或數字後,系統依舊視為文字。必須重新編輯一下 比如雙擊進行編輯狀態,什麼也不做,回車退出也可轉換過來 進...
excel數字轉換為日期格式
直接右鍵,修改單元格格式,在自定義裡面編輯 yyyy 年 m 月 d 日 h mm am pm 就可以了。假設 2 21 2014 2 48 pm 寫在a1單元格,則另一單元格寫入公式 再設定單元格格式為 x年x月x日 x時x分 的格式或公式寫成 ctrl 1...